3. Code examples of localstorage:
The following are some code examples that use localStorage for data storage and operation:
- Add data:
localStorage. setItem("name", "John");//Add data with key "name" and value "John" in localStorage - Query data:
var name = localStorage.getItem(" name"); // Get the value with the key "name" from localStorage - Update data:
localStorage.setItem("name", "Tom");// Update the key as "name" The value is "Tom" - Delete data:
localStorage.removeItem("name");//Delete the data with the key "name" from localStorage
Required Note that localStorage stores string type data. If you need to store complex data structures, you can use JSON.stringify and JSON.parse for conversion.
